It was edited by the organizers of the summer school held in August 2011 in University of California, Berkeley, as part of a collaborative program between the University of Tokyo and UC Berkeley. Motivated by the particular relevance and importance of social-scientific approaches to various crucial aspects of nuclear technology, special emphasis was placed on integrating nuclear science and engineering with social science. The book consists of the lectures given in 2011 summer school and additional chapters that cover developments in the past three years since the accident. It provides an arena for discussions to find and create a renewed platform for engineering practices, and thus nuclear engineering education, which are essential in the post-Fukushima era for nurturing nuclear engineers who need to be both technically competent and trusted in society.","brand":"WoB","offers":[{"title":"GB \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":52433539727633,"sku":"NLS9783319120898","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0784\/4072\/6801\/files\/9783319120898.jpg?v=1759178315"},{"product_id":"reflections-on-the-fukushima-daiichi-nuclear-accident-book-joonhong-ahn-9783319363462","title":"Reflections on the Fukushima Daiichi Nuclear Accident","description":"This book focuses on nuclear engineering education in the post-Fukushima era. This book summarizes presentations and discussions from the two-day international workshop held at UC Berkeley in March 2015, and derives questions to be addressed in multi-disciplinary research toward a new paradigm of nuclear safety. The consequences of the Fukushima Daiichi nuclear accident in March 2011 have fuelled the debate on nuclear safety: while there were no casualties due to radiation, there was substantial damage to local communities. The lack of common understanding of the basics of environmental and radiological sciences has made it difficult for stakeholders to develop effective strategies to accelerate recovery, and this is compounded by a lack of effective decision-making due to the eroded public trust in the government and operators. Recognizing that making a society resilient and achieving higher levels of safety relies on public participation in and feedback on decision-making, the book focuses on risk perception and mitigation in its discussion of the development of resilient communities.","brand":"WoB","offers":[{"title":"- \/ - \/ INTERNAL","offer_id":52480010879249,"sku":null,"price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true},{"title":"GB \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":52480011927825,"sku":"NLS9783319864716","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0784\/4072\/6801\/files\/9783319864716.jpg?v=1759849593"},{"product_id":"resilience-a-new-paradigm-of-nuclear-safety-book-joonhong-ahn-9783319587677","title":"Resilience: A New Paradigm of Nuclear Safety","description":"This book is published open access under a CC BY 4.0 license.
